/*
* we want to get all the spaces a user belongs either directly or via a group
* we will pass the user id and workspace id as parameters
* if the user is a member of the space via multiple groups
* we will return the one with the highest role permission
* it should return an array
* Todo: needs more work. this is a draft
*/
async getUserSpaces(userId: string, workspaceId: string) {
const rolePriority = sql`CASE "space_members"."role"
WHEN 'owner' THEN 3
WHEN 'writer' THEN 2
WHEN 'reader' THEN 1
END`.as('role_priority');
const subquery = this.db
.selectFrom('spaces')
.innerJoin('space_members', 'spaces.id', 'space_members.spaceId')
.select([
'spaces.id',
'spaces.name',
'spaces.slug',
'spaces.icon',
'space_members.role',
rolePriority,
])
.where('space_members.userId', '=', userId)
.where('spaces.workspaceId', '=', workspaceId)
.unionAll(
this.db
.selectFrom('spaces')
.innerJoin('space_members', 'spaces.id', 'space_members.spaceId')
.innerJoin(
'group_users',
'space_members.groupId',
'group_users.groupId',
)
.select([
'spaces.id',
'spaces.name',
'spaces.slug',
'spaces.icon',
'space_members.role',
rolePriority,
])
.where('group_users.userId', '=', userId),
)
.as('membership');
const results = await this.db
.selectFrom(subquery)
.select([
'membership.id as space_id',
'membership.name as space_name',
'membership.slug as space_slug',
sql`MAX('role_priority')`.as('max_role_priority'),
sql`CASE MAX("role_priority")
WHEN 3 THEN 'owner'
WHEN 2 THEN 'writer'
WHEN 1 THEN 'reader'
END`.as('highest_role'),
])
.groupBy('membership.id')
.groupBy('membership.name')
.groupBy('membership.slug')
.execute();
let membership = {};
const spaces = results.map((result) => {
membership = {
id: result.space_id,
name: result.space_name,
role: result.highest_role,
};
return membership;
});
return spaces;
}
/*
* we want to get a user's role in a space.
* they user can be a member either directly or via a group
* we will pass the user id and space id and workspaceId to return the user's role
* if the user is a member of the space via multiple groups
* we will return the one with the highest role permission
* It returns the space id, space name, user role
* and how the role was derived 'via'
* if the user has no space permission (not a member) it returns undefined
*/
async getUserRoleInSpace(
userId: string,
spaceId: string,
workspaceId: string,
) {
const rolePriority = sql`CASE "space_members"."role"
WHEN 'owner' THEN 3
WHEN 'writer' THEN 2
WHEN 'reader' THEN 1
END`.as('role_priority');
const subquery = this.db
.selectFrom('spaces')
.innerJoin('space_members', 'spaces.id', 'space_members.spaceId')
.select([
'spaces.id',
'spaces.name',
'space_members.role',
'space_members.userId',
rolePriority,
])
.where('space_members.userId', '=', userId)
.where('spaces.id', '=', spaceId)
.where('spaces.workspaceId', '=', workspaceId)
.unionAll(
this.db
.selectFrom('spaces')
.innerJoin('space_members', 'spaces.id', 'space_members.spaceId')
.innerJoin(
'group_users',
'space_members.groupId',
'group_users.groupId',
)
.select([
'spaces.id',
'spaces.name',
'space_members.role',
'space_members.userId',
rolePriority,
])
.where('spaces.id', '=', spaceId)
.where('spaces.workspaceId', '=', workspaceId)
.where('group_users.userId', '=', userId),
)
.as('membership');
const result = await this.db
.selectFrom(subquery)
.select([
'membership.id as space_id',
'membership.name as space_name',
'membership.userId as user_id',
sql`MAX('role_priority')`.as('max_role_priority'),
sql`CASE MAX("role_priority")
WHEN 3 THEN 'owner'
WHEN 2 THEN 'writer'
WHEN 1 THEN 'reader'
END`.as('highest_role'),
])
.groupBy('membership.id')
.groupBy('membership.name')
.groupBy('membership.userId')
.executeTakeFirst();
let membership = {};
if (result) {
membership = {
id: result.space_id,
name: result.space_name,
role: result.highest_role,
via: result.user_id ? 'user' : 'group', // user_id is empty then role was derived via a group
};
return membership;
}
return undefined;
}
